#d91a38 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d91a38 is composed of 85.1% red, 10.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88% magenta, 74.2%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 350.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 47.6%. #d91a38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3470 with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d91a38

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070102 is the darkest color, while #fef4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d91a38

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7778 is the less saturated color, while #ec072b is the most saturated one.
